Suggestion on Optimizing Flow and Sediment Regulations as the Operational Methods of the Xiaolangdi Reservoir

Sun Zan-ying

Open publisher page 4 citations

Abstract

This paper analyzed the condition of the lower Yellow River channel after the operations of Xiaolangdi Reservoir and major problems of flow and sediment regulations.It also researched on the and deposition properties of the river bed of the lower reaches during the man-made flood peak.The results show that,after the man-made flood peak and clear water scours for 10 years,the flood discharge capacity of the lower reaches has been effectively restored,which creates favorable condition for transporting sediment by flood.Consecutive flow and sediment regulations for 10 times,have resulted in less efficiency,and new situations occurred like deposition in the lower reaches during sediment discharge,as well as the increase of discharge along the main stem.The flood has the characteristics of scour in rising and deposit in falling,so it is suggested that the Xiaolangdi Reservoir should change its operational method of discharging sediment during falling period.Sediment should be discharged during the rising period of the flood hydrograph and a flood peak that with a gentle hydrograph and longer duration shouldn't be created.This way,the efficiency of sediment transport in the lower reaches can be increased.
